To stop a dishwasher cycle, you just need to push the stop or pause option on your dishwasher. Another way is to open the door or latch slightly and wait a few seconds or minutes for its operations to stop. Dishwashers automatically stop if you open the door or latch.
Remember not to stop it during its last phase or by the end of the cycle. If you are stopping it to put in another dish, you will want to do it during the initial phases. This is because if you put a dish in the later phases, the previous dishes will already be washed and cleaned and your added dish would not be cleaned properly. Another reason for this is that inhaling detergents and dishwashing soaps cannot be good for your health.
If you open it suddenly in the middle or later phases, you are likely to breathe in air filled with chemicals and detergents. To sum up, it is better not to open a dishwasher while it is running.
But in urgent situations, you can add a few items depending on the stage of the cycle. Check the detergent dispenser prior to opening the door. If the dispenser is closed, it is safe to add the remaining dishes. If the detergent dispenser is open, try washing the utensils outside by hand or wait for the next cycle. How long is a dishwasher cycle? The average dishwasher cycle lasts between two to four hours. Some cycles add time. Why do dishwashers take so long to wash? The objective was to have dishwashers clean just as well despite using less water and electricity.
Manufacturers accomplished this, in part, by having their machines run longer. With less water to spray, the machines spray longer, using higher-efficiency motors and pumps.
